Georgian Silver Memento Mori Ring with Skull 18th century AD A silver ring with exceptionally broad band, circular raised bezel depicting an incase facing skull; the band engraved with Gothic 'BREVE ET IRREPARABILE / TEMPUS OMNIBUS VITA' inscription taken from Virgil's Aeneid 

'brief and irrecoverable is the time all have of life' 

in two lines divided by a central segmented band; a punched 'X-above-crescent' maker's mark to the inside. 19.30 grams, 24.13mm overall, 18.33mm internal diameter (approximate size British P 1/2, USA 7 3/4, Europe 16.86, Japan 16) (1").
